The coupe combines avant-garde aesthetics and advanced technology, including plug-in hybrid electric vehicle propulsion, in a single package. It is the fourth global concept vehicle jointly developed by GM's Shanghai GM and Pan Asia Technical Automotive Center (PATAC) joint ventures in Shanghai.

Elegant Design Inspired by the Dynamic Nature of Water
The new Riviera's designers took inspiration from the Chinese saying: "The greatest good is like water." The vehicle's sweeping design, which goes from thick to thin, has the vibrant nature of a moving river embodied in its athletic shape, elegant ambience and deeply sculpted lines.

The concept's silhouette with Buick's recognizable "sweep spear" has a three-dimensional effect that resembles waves in the ocean coming to a standstill for a split second. Buick's unique gull-wing doors exude a dynamic yet elegant ambience. The new Riviera has an ice celadon finish inspired by jade.

Up front, the concept vehicle's updated waterfall grille and wing-shaped daytime running lights will both become key elements of Buick's future design DNA.

The new Riviera has a low drag coefficient and a harmonious balance between style and performance thanks to its raked windshield, 14-degree fastback design and metallic fiber spoiler, which are complemented by active grille shutters and diffusers, and active pneumatic wheels.

The interior carries on Buick's signature 360-degree integrated design with high levels of elegance and refinement. The eaglewood tone interior features the abundant use of refined materials such as sand-blasted aluminum alloy, lava suede and ebony used in a bold style reminiscent of traditional Chinese jade-inlaid wood. This creates a striking visual effect as well as a subdued sense of luxury.

The new Riviera's compact yet well-structured center console, front floating seats and adaptive seating system, as well as its noise-absorbing head restraint system, represent the best combination of interior design and elegance.

Innovative Propulsion, Infotainment and Safety Technology
The new Riviera has adopted BIP (Buick Intelligent Performance) technology. It is equipped with GM's all-new, dual-mode W-PHEV (wireless plug-in hybrid electric vehicle) propulsion system. The user can drive the car on green power in electric mode and enjoy the exhilarating handling and performance of a sports car while driving "green" in hybrid mode. In addition, the vehicle can be charged with a traditional cable or wirelessly via a sensory recharge panel on the car's chassis. The charging port is integrated into Buick's iconic porthole design.

The new Riviera is also equipped with intelligent four-wheel steering, an electromagnetic-controlled suspension and an air spring package for sure handling and comfort in extreme conditions.

The innovative mobile Internet system adopted in the new Riviera supports high-speed 4G LTE network use. The concept vehicle offers real-time traffic information, weather updates, and news and entertainment while communicating with other vehicles. The vehicle's voice commands and controls along with touch and gesture recognition activate a range of vehicle systems and enable seamless interaction between driver and vehicle.

The new Riviera employs a forward-looking active safety system that collects traffic information through 10 high-resolution cameras (for image monitoring) and 18 micro high-precision sensors (for distance monitoring). The information is integrated and presented in a holographic image onto the windshield.

The intelligent driver assist system provides occupants a high level of active safety and security. The system incorporates a variety of driver assist functions, including: an eagle view record system, night view assist, side blind-zone alert system, lane departure warning system, full-speed range-adaptive cruise control system, lane change assist system, parking assist system, rear cross-traffic alert system, autopilot system and "transparent" A pillars.

Biome 2010 Mercedes-Benz Concept Car

 
The designers from the Mercedes-Benz Advanced Design Studios in Carlsbad, California, surprised everyone at the 2010 Los Angeles Design Challenge with a revolutionary vision. The Mercedes Biome Concept previews an ultralight vehicle, inspired by nature, that aims for unparalleled efficiency.
The Mercedes-Benz BIOME Concept symbiosis vehicle is made from an ultralight material called BioFibre and tips the scales at just 875.5 lbs (around 394 kg). This material is significantly lighter than metal or plastic, yet more robust than steel. BioFibre is grown from proprietary DNA in the Mercedes-Benz nursery, where it collects energy from the sun and stores it in a liquid chemical bond called BioNectar4534. As part of this process, the vehicle is created from two seeds: The interior of the BIOME grows from the DNA in the Mercedes star on the front of the vehicle, while the exterior grows from the star on the rear. To accommodate specific customer requirements, the Mercedes star is genetically engineered in each case, and the vehicle “grows” when the genetic code is combined with the seed capsule. The wheels are grown from four separate seeds.


"As the inventor of the motor car, we wanted to illustrate the vision of the perfect vehicle of the future, which is created and functions in complete symbiosis with nature. The Mercedes-Benz BIOME Concept is a natural technology hybrid, and forms part of our earth's ecosystem. It grows and thrives like the leaves on a tree" according to Hubert Lee, Head of the Mercedes-Benz Advanced Design Studios in Carlsbad. This year the competition had called for the creation of a vision of a safe and comfortable 2+2 compact car featuring good handling and a first-class design.


Even Mercedes Biome concept has a lenght of about 4 meters and is 2,5 meters wide, the German concept designed in California is still able to provide a total mass of just 394 kilograms, thus, it fits the requirements of the contest in question.


The Mercedes-Benz BIOME Concept is powered by BioNectar4534, which is stored in the BioFibre material of the chassis, interior, and wheels. In addition, Mercedes-Benz has developed a technology to equip trees with special receptors which can collect the excess solar energy and turn it into BioNectar4534. This creates a direct link with nature's energy sources and acts as an incentive to cover mobility energy requirements through more trees and at the same time maintain natural resources. Like plants, the Mercedes-Benz symbiosis vehicle also produces oxygen, thereby contributing to improving air quality. At the end of its service life, the Mercedes-Benz BIOME can be fully composted or used as building material. Thanks to the exclusive use of green technologies, the BIOME vehicle thus blends seamlessly into the ecosystem.

Fisker Atlantic Concept, 2012

 
 
 
 

The Fisker Automotive is pleased to unveil its all-new model, the Atlantic sedan. This is the latest model in the company's expanding line up of extended-range luxury electric cars.
Revealed as a design prototype at a special VIP preview event the night before the 2012 New York Auto Show press days begin, the Fisker Atlantic design prototype is a luxury four-door sporting sedan with a practical interior. It is aimed at young families who want to drive an impactful, high-end vehicle while making a positive statement about responsibilities - both in terms of their commitment to sustainability and the practicalities of everyday life.

The Atlantic uses the latest second generation EVer (Electric Vehicle with extended range) technology. It will offer all the benefits of electric drive while at the same time eliminating the "range anxiety" experienced with an all-electric powertrain.

Like the Karma sedan, the Fisker Atlantic is a plug-in series hybrid vehicle that allows drivers to switch manually or automatically between electric and gasoline driving modes and sustain the charge of its lithium ion batteries on the move.

Its 4-cylinder gasoline engine, which acts as a generator and is not mechanically connected to the wheels, is tuned to offer maximum economy and high torque. This Atlantic EVer powertrain will offer highly competitive performance for a car in its class. The standard powertrain will be configured for rear-wheel drive and an all-wheel drive version will be offered as an option.

The Atlantic design prototype's glass roof shows off a ridged 'spider' structure. This incredibly strong construction also allows the Atlantic to offer a remarkable amount of rear headroom for a car with its sleek, coupe-like stance. This high-tech approach fulfills and surpasses all current and future rollover safety and crash-test requirements worldwide. The Fisker Atlantic's long wheelbase also affords extra legroom for rear passengers and more space in the trunk.

The unique, exciting styling of the Atlantic retains and progresses Fisker's signature design DNA. Henrik Fisker and his design team set out to create the most beautiful and dramatic vehicle in its class. Much of the design was inspired by nature, for example, the dynamic side theme, with strong sculptural lines that optically cross the center and over the rear wheels of the car. This gives a sense of power - replicating the stance of a wild tiger ready to pounce.

The important design details to note include an evolution of the Fisker Karma signature grille, with a wider sculptured line defining the power dome on the hood. Strong creases emerge from the inside of the headlamps and continue back over the hood to elongate the car. The sharp headlights themselves give an 'eagle eye' with a strength of strong character not seen on a production car before. These touches allow the Atlantic to create a greater rear-view mirror presence than any other vehicle in its class.

The rear door handles have been elegantly integrated in the rear C-pillars, to continue the sense and look of a sporting coupe without losing the practicality of a four-door sedan. The extremely slim LED tail lamps use the latest technology allowing them to split into two parts to offer a wider aperture for the trunk opening. The rear end of the car is clean and aerodynamically shaped, with a sharp spoiler lip on the trunk that runs down over the side of the car to enhance aerodynamic performance.

Overall, the Fisker Atlantic's dimensions are comparable to those of an Audi A5. It has been engineered inside and out to offer a dynamic yet compact feel on the road

Bugatti Galibier Concept, 2009






As the climax of its centenary celebration ceremonies, Bugatti Automobiles S.A.S. presented customers and opinion-makers with the Bugatti Galibier Concept, intended to be the most exclusive, elegant, and powerful four door automobile in the world last weekend in Molsheim.

Technique: those are the brand values to which Ettore Bugatti and his son Jean oriented themselves in order to develop even more powerful engines and even more noble body designs for each new model, which were without equal in quality, handling, speed and elegance. In the process, they experimented again and again without compromise with new materials; thus was Bugatti one of the first manufacturers to use aluminium parts for bodies, engine blocks and wheels.

Technique are also the brand values to which the design and engineering team of Bugatti Automobiles S.A.S. oriented themselves in the development of the Bugatti Galibier. With this new four-door concept car, Bugatti assumes anew a leading role in the use of new material combinations. Thus the body is constructed of handmade carbon fibre parts coloured dark blue so that, when illuminated, the woven structure shimmers through strikingly. Carbon fibre not only possesses unusually great rigidity but is also especially light. The wings and doors are out of polished aluminium.

The Bugatti Galibier's design masters the challenge of uniting sportiness with the comfort and elegance of a modern four-door saloon. The basic architecture picks up on the torpedo-like character of the Type 35, which was already revived in the Bugatti Veyron, and reinterprets it. With the typical Bugatti radiator grille, big round LED headlights and the clamshell running the length of the vehicle which became synonymous with the brand identity under Jean Bugatti in the Type 57, this car transports the Bugatti genes into the modern world.

Beneath the bonnet, which folds back from both sides, there resides a 16-cylinder, 8-litre engine with twostage supercharging. What makes this engine special is that it was developed as a flex-fuel engine and can optional be run on ethanol. Four-wheel drive, specially developed ceramic brakes and a new suspension design enable the agile, always-sure handling of a saloon of this size.

The interior reflects the elemental design of the exterior. The dash panel has been reduced to the essential; two centrally located main instruments keep even the rear passengers constantly informed of the actual speed and previous performance. Parmigiani, the Swiss maker of fine watches, created the removable Reverso Tourbillon clock for the Bugatti Galibier, which may be worn on the wrist thanks to a cleverly designed leather strap.

Lamborghini Egoista Concept, 2013


 
 
 


An emotional moment in Sant'Agata Bolognese at the culmination of the gala celebrating Lamborghini's 50th anniversary: Walter De Silva's incredible vehicle made its entry in front of a thousand invitees, the Head of Design for the Volkswagen Group's homage to celebrating the House of the Raging Bull's half century. "I am very attached to this Italian brand, being an Italian myself. I wanted to pay homage to and think up a vehicle to underline the fact that Lamborghinis have always been made with passion, and with the heart more than the head," said an emotional De Silva.

The Egoista, as the vehicle has been christened, is a car forged from a passion for innovation and alternative solutions, the same passion which has always set the Lamborghini brand apart. "This is a car made for one person only, to allow them to have fun and express their personality to the maximum. It is designed purely for hyper-sophisticated people who want only the most extreme and special things in the world. It represents hedonism taken to the extreme, it is a car without compromises, in a word: egoista (selfish)," De Silva further explained.

The supercar's debut was equally spectacular, with a cinematic entry announced by a trailer projected onto the nine big screens in the room. The stage was transformed into a landing strip, with a top model in a flight suit guiding the Egoista's arrival with ground crew light paddles, and the roar of the V10 engine shaking the 20-meter-tall tensioned event structure: this is the spectacle the VIP guests were treated to when Lamborghini President and CEO Stephan Winkelmann entered at the wheel of the Egoista, before inviting its creator, Walter De Silva, to join him on stage.

The Concept and technology
Powered by a 5.2-liter V10 engine supplying it with 600 horsepower, the Lamborghini Egoista is an intentionally extreme and unusual vehicle with absolutely unique characteristics, created by the Volkswagen Group design team - Alessandro Dambrosio responsible for the exterior and Stefan Sielaff for the interior, in particular. De Silva's team chose to create a single-seater, pushing all the characteristics in Lamborghini's make-up meaning pure driving pleasure, performance and style beyond their limits. The cockpit, designed like a tailor-made suit for the driver, is a removable section which, once combined with the rest of the vehicle, creates a perfect technical, mechanical and aerodynamic unit. Inspiration, as per Lamborghini tradition, once again comes from the world of aviation, and in particular the Apache helicopter, where the cockpit can be ejected in an emergency.

The design
The exterior is characterized by two fundamental aspects: its architecture, and the materials used. The design is determined by a highly muscular structure, in which empty and solid areas fit together with strength and vigor. The bodywork is dominated, on its sides, by the stylized profile of a bull preparing to charge, its horns lowered. The bull is driving towards the front wheels, conferring a futuristic dynamism and lines which are already, in themselves, highly aggressive. Naturally, this is a homage, a bold stylistic citation which can only be a reworking of the Lamborghini brand icon, the well-known raging bull. The challenge of efficiently inserting the Lamborghini symbol as an integral part of the bodywork was met courageously and artistically. The plan view reveals a trimaran profile, where the central hull forms a unique section with the cockpit, underlined by the carbon-fiber cover on the front hood.

The upper part of the vehicle does not have aerodynamic appendages, but rather flaps integrated in the bodywork profile which act automatically depending on the driving conditions. Two rear flaps activate automatically at high speeds to increase stability, while a series of air intakes on the back of the engine hood provides the cooling air flow to the powerful V10 power plant. While the front of the vehicle has a profile intended to increase downforce, the rear is fully open with the mechanics in view, reducing weight but also with the result of creating a more aggressive look. The Lamborghini Egoista's lights are more like an aircraft's than a road vehicle's. It does not have traditional headlights, rather LED clearance lights which determine its position not just on a single plane such as the road, but rather in three dimensions, as is required in airspace. Two white front lights, two red rear lights, a red flashing light in the upper part of the tail, two orange bull's eyes as side markers, and a further two lights on the roof, red on the left and green on the right, make this four-wheeled UFO unique even in the dark. Finally, hidden behind the front air intakes at the base of the join between the central body and the two side sections, are two powerful xenon headlamps, two eagle's eyes able to scan the darkness for great distances. As it is made from lightweight materials such as aluminum and carbon-fiber, the vehicle has no-walk zones, duly marked like on airliners. The parallels with the world of aeronautics do not end here, however, as the body is made from a special antiradar material, and the glass is anti-glare with an orange gradation. The rims are also made from antiradar material, flat and rough, embellished with carbon-fiber plates to improve their aerodynamics.

The Interior
The cockpit's interior is extremely rational, its functionality taken to the extreme. There is a racing seat with a four-point seatbelt, each strip a different color, the airbags, and the bare minimum of instruments. The focal point of these is a head-up display, typical of jet fighters. To get out of the vehicle, the driver must remove the steering wheel and rest it on the dashboard, open the dome with an electronic command, stand up in their seat, sit down on a precise point of the left-hand bodywork, then swivel their legs 180 degrees from the inside of the cockpit to the outside of the vehicle. At this point they can set their feet down and stand up. Even in getting out of the vehicle, the Lamborghini Egoista requires a pilot more than a driver, a real top gun.

The philosophy
The Egoista contains, in Walter De Silva's opinion, all the product criteria which are part of Lamborghini's make-up. "It's as if Ferruccio Lamborghini were saying: I'm going to put the engine in the back, I don't want a passenger. I want it for myself, and I want it as I imagine it to be. It is a fanatical vehicle, Egoista fits it well."

If Lamborghinis are cars for the few, this one goes further. It is a car for itself, a gift from Lamborghini to Lamborghini, resplendent in its solitude. The Egoista is pure emotion, Never Never Land, which no one can ever possess, and which will always remain a dream, for everyone.

Sesto Elemento Lamborghini Concept Car

 

 
The Lamborghini Sesto Elemento Concept has been presented live at the 2010 Paris Motor Show. The name derives from Italian for "sixth element" on the periodic table, carbon--and the Sesto Elemento is described as "a technology demonstrator" constructed for the show to give an idea how the future of Lamborghini will include carbon-fiber construction techniques.


“The Lamborghini Sesto Elemento shows how the future of the super sports car can look – extreme lightweight engineering, combined with extreme performance results in extreme driving fun. We put all of our technological competence into one stunning form to create the Sesto Elemento,” said Stephan Winkelmann, President and CEO of Automobili Lamborghini.

“It is our abilities in carbon-fiber technology that have facilitated such a forward-thinking concept, and we of course also benefit from the undisputed lightweight expertise of Audi AG. Systematic lightweight engineering is crucial for future super sports cars: for the most dynamic performance, as well as for low emissions. We will apply this technological advantage right across our model range. Every future Lamborghini will be touched by the spirit of the Sesto Elemento,” said Stephan Winkelmann, President and CEO of Automobili Lamborghini.
The show car is powered by a 562bhp version of the V10 used in the current Gallardo. But thanks to the widespread use of carbon fibre, the concept cars tips the scales at only 999kg. Lamborghini claims the Sesto Elemento will sprint from 0-62mph in 2.5 seconds and on to a top speed of more than 200mph.


The Lamborghini Concept Car - Sesto Elemento Lamborghini Concept has a power-weight ratio of 1.75 kg/hp. It reaches 100 km/hr in just 2.5 seconds and has a top speed of “well over 300 km/hr”. It’s exactly the kind of supercar innovation that Lamborghini should be investing in and while carbon fibre has become famous, the company has also experimented with other modern materials, such as Pyrosic for the exhaust system (a new glass and ceramic composite material).


The Lamborghini Advanced Composite Structures Laboratory (ACSL) at the University of Washington in Seattle, USA, uses experimental tests to define the mechanical behaviour of the different materials and technologies using methodology from the aviation industry.

The design is inspired by the limited-edition Reventòn supercar, but makes more of a feature of its deep front end, while the V10 is open to the elements. The Sesto Elemento isn’t road legal, but it is a running prototype, so testing Lamborghini’s claims is a possibility.
